Mornings often set the tone for the entire day, and many people like to begin with small habits that make them feel grounded. One such routine that has gained attention is sipping warm water right after waking up. While it may seem simple, many believe it can help the body ease into the day more smoothly.

Some health professionals suggest that drinking warm water on an empty stomach may support the body’s natural cleansing processes. They often explain that the warmth can help your system wake up gently, encouraging the body to release what it no longer needs and promoting a sense of internal freshness.

There is also the idea that warm water could help the body’s metabolism function more efficiently. People who follow this habit regularly often report feeling lighter or more active, which may be connected to better digestion and improved energy levels throughout the day.

With consistency, many individuals say they experience better circulation and smoother digestion. They feel that nutrients seem to move through the body more effectively, and any heaviness or bloating appears to lessen.

Overall, those who embrace this practice describe feeling more refreshed and comfortable in their bodies. While warm water alone isn’t a cure-all, beginning the day with something soothing and intentional can be a small act of care that sets a positive rhythm.
